Featherstone Train Station, nestled within the charming town of Featherstone, West Yorkshire, serves as a pivotal community hub. While it might not boast the extensive facilities of its larger counterparts, it is an essential gateway for both everyday commuters and adventurous travelers alike. Whether you're planning a daily commute or a leisurely trip, understanding the station's offerings can help you make an informed travel decision and ease your journey.
The station is devoid of a traditional ticket office but ensures a smooth ticket purchasing experience with available ticket machines, including accessible ones on Platform 1, allowing for the collection of tickets bought online. While staff assistance is not available on-site, customer information can be accessed through screens and announcements. Rest assured, step-free access is afforded in parts of the station, promising ease for wheelchair users and other passengers with mobility needs. Boarding ramps are carried on all trains, providing further reassurance. While amenities such as luggage storage, seating areas, and food outlets are absent, the proximity of Featherstone’s town center offers convenient alternatives within walking distance.
Featherstone Station is conveniently connected to various transport options for seamless onward travel. Rail replacement services are accessible on Station Lane next to the level crossing, ensuring continuity of travel during service interruptions. For those preferring taxis, services can be arranged through Northern Railway’s dedicated taxi booking service. Additionally, there is a nearby bus stop with Busline information available at 0870 608 2608. For further metro services, inquiries can be directed to WYPTE at 0113 245 7676.

Swanscombe Train Station, nestled in Kent, is a charming portal with well-rounded facilities ensuring a convenient travel experience for its passengers. Whether you are a local commuter or an explorer eager to discover nearby gems, Swanscombe's station offers practical amenities and a touch of historical charm, being close to various points of interest.
The station is equipped with essential ticket facilities, including a ticket office open weekdays from 06:10 to 12:50 and Saturdays from 08:40 to 15:20. There's also a ticket machine for those who prefer a self-service option. Collecting pre-booked tickets is straightforward, ensuring convenience for all travelers.
Accessibility support is available although the station is categorized as 'C' meaning it doesn't offer step-free access. Nonetheless, assistance with navigation and ramps for train access are in place, supported by helpful staff during opening hours. For those planning to carry their bicycles, Swanscombe station provides six sheltered spaces, allowing passengers to park their cycles with ease, although cycle hire is not available here.
Swanscombe also enjoys connectivity beyond rail, boasting additional transport options like the local bus service. The rail replacement service ensures uninterrupted journeys towards Greenhithe and Northfleet with accessible stops. For those looking to continue their travel via bus, printable schedules are conveniently available here, facilitating smooth transitions between modes of transport.
